The Role of Temperature in Egg Safety
Temperature is perhaps the most critical factor influencing the safety and quality of boiled eggs. The danger zone for bacterial growth is between 40°F and 140°F. When stored within this temperature range, boiled eggs are at a higher risk of supporting the growth of harmful bacteria. It is recommended to cool boiled eggs promptly and store them in a refrigerator at a temperature of 40°F or below to slow down bacterial growth.
Guidelines for Storing Boiled Eggs Without Refrigeration
While it is always best to store boiled eggs in a refrigerator, there may be situations where this is not possible. In such cases, it is vital to follow strict guidelines to minimize the risk of bacterial contamination and foodborne illness.
- Boiled eggs should be cooled rapidly after cooking to prevent the growth of bacteria.
- They should be stored in a clean, dry environment. Moisture can encourage bacterial growth, so it is crucial to keep the eggs dry.
- The storage area should be cool, ideally below 70°F, though this is not as safe as refrigeration.
- Boiled eggs should not be left at room temperature for more than 2 hours. If the temperature is above 90°F, this time is reduced to 1 hour.

Recognizing Spoilage in Boiled Eggs
Identifying spoiled boiled eggs can be challenging, but there are a few indicators to look out for:
– Slime or Cracks: If the egg-white or yolk has a slimy texture or if there are visible cracks in the egg, it may be contaminated.
– Off Smell: Boiled eggs should have a neutral smell. A strong, unpleasant odor can indicate bacterial growth.
– Visible Mold: Although less common, mold can grow on boiled eggs, especially if they have been improperly stored.

How long can boiled eggs be left out without refrigeration?
Boiled eggs should not be left out without refrigeration for more than two hours, and this time frame is further reduced if the room temperature is above 90°F (32°C). This is because bacterial growth, particularly Salmonella, can occur rapidly between 40°F (4°C) and 140°F (60°C), which is known as the “danger zone.” When boiled eggs are left at room temperature, especially in warmer environments, the risk of contamination increases significantly. It’s crucial to handle boiled eggs safely to prevent foodborne illness.
In practice, if you’ve boiled eggs and they’ve been out for a couple of hours, it’s best to err on the side of caution. If the eggs have been exposed to temperatures above 90°F (32°C) for any length of time, they should be discarded to avoid the risk of food poisoning. The Centers for Disease Control and Prevention (CDC) and other food safety organizations emphasize the importance of prompt refrigeration of perishable foods like eggs to keep them safe to eat. Refrigerating boiled eggs at a temperature of 40°F (4°C) or below inhibits the growth of harmful bacteria, making them safe for consumption for several days.

How should boiled eggs be stored to maximize their shelf life without refrigeration?
To maximize the shelf life of boiled eggs without refrigeration, they should be cooled as quickly as possible after boiling. This can be done by immediately transferring the eggs to a bowl of ice water after the boiling process. Once cooled, the eggs should be dried with a clean towel to remove excess moisture, which can facilitate bacterial growth. They can then be stored in a sealed container to prevent contamination. If possible, storing them in a shaded, cool area or using a cooler with ice packs can extend their safe storage time.
The storage conditions, including the cleanliness of the storage area and the containers used, play a significant role in preventing contamination. Regularly checking the eggs for any signs of spoilage, such as an off smell, slimy texture, or visible mold, is crucial. Even with proper storage and handling, boiled eggs should not be stored without refrigeration for more than a couple of hours, especially in warm environments.
